We are looking for a Lunchtime Supervisor who:
Fully support the ethos of the school
Be willing to participate with games and activities; both in and outdoors. These activities can vary on a daily basis so need to be tolerate of change
Be a team player with good interpersonal skills
Be patient, caring, understanding, positive and supportive
Support pupils while they eat their lunch, making sure tables are clean and that water is available
Ensure table manners are maintained
Report accident forms if necessary
Ensure that school discipline & Child Protection policies are implemented
Support the work of other Lunchtime Supervisors & school staff
Respond well to delegation as required by the supervisor & senior members of staff
Record inappropriate pupil behaviour and convey serious incidents to the senior leaders
Maintain checks throughout the lunch break to ensure pupils are safe
Have good communication skills
Act as a positive role model

Commitment to safeguarding
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.
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.
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children
You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.
